Rosso to host Mumbrella360 conference
Writer, broadcaster and comedian Tim Ross is to host next month’s Mumbrella360 conference.
Rosso spent a decade on radio including on Triple J and Sydney’s Nova 96.9. He left the station in 2009. Since then he has published a book and is currently fronting an advertising campaign for NRMA. He has also returned to live comedy.
Mumbrella360 – which will see around 600 people watch four streams of presentations and debate over two days – takes place at the Hilton Hotel in Sydney on June 7 and 8.
The event encompasses all aspects of advertising, media, marketing, PR and social media.
